Gregorio Paltrinieri and Giulia Gabrielleschi both claimed by just 0.1secs in their respective men’s and women’s races at the LEN Open Water Cup in Piombino, Italy.
Olympic bronze medallist Paltrinieri won in 1:53:46.4 ahead of fellow Italian Domenico Acerenza who clocked 1:53:46.5.
Tokyo silver medallist Kristof Rasovszky of Hungary was narrowly behind in 1:53:47.2 in third as only 10secs separated the top 12 men.
Gabrielleschi and Germany’s Leonie Beck fought shoulder-to-shoulder at the end and the Italian was just a fraction of a second faster in touching in 2:03:25.6 to 2:03:25.7.
Martina de Memme, winner of Leg 1, was a further 2.7sec adrift for bronze in 2:03:28.3 with 10secs separating the top 10.
